Transaction 41f0623ec65b8eccf11ef5690a92ec298f8f1bf630c2af2a21efc07d57979113

17 Input
2 Outputs
  • 41f0623ec65b8eccf11ef5690a92ec298f8f1bf630c2af2a21efc07d57979113:0
  • value  13000000
    address  1CtB94hmGyCef2sFSqwZDaoabLVEtmxB7j
  • 41f0623ec65b8eccf11ef5690a92ec298f8f1bf630c2af2a21efc07d57979113:1
  • value  971106
    address  1DPvAwGtBfMusiLCuGmLu8bv17ZZH3ZQPD